inherent vs inherent problem

Both "inherent" and "inherent problem" are correct, but they are used in different contexts. "Inherent" is an adjective that describes a quality or characteristic that is essential and permanent, while "inherent problem" is a common collocation used to refer to a problem that is an essential part of something.

This is a correct adjective used to describe a quality or characteristic that is essential and permanent.

"inherent"

Use "inherent" to describe something that is an essential and permanent part of a person, thing, or situation.

Examples:

  • The inherent beauty of nature cannot be denied.
  • There are inherent risks in any business venture.

This is a common collocation used to refer to a problem that is an essential part of something.

"inherent problem"

Use "inherent problem" to refer to a problem that is an essential and permanent part of a person, thing, or situation.

Examples:

  • One inherent problem with the current system is its lack of scalability.
  • The project faced several inherent problems from the beginning.
